Centos下磁盤管理
1.磁盤分區(qū)格式說明
linux分區(qū)不同于windows,linux下硬盤設(shè)備名為(IDE硬盤為hdx(x為從a—d)因?yàn)镮DE硬盤最多四個(gè),SCSI,SATA,USB硬盤為sdx(x為a—z)),硬盤主分區(qū)最多為4個(gè),不用說大家也知道…..所以主分區(qū)從sdb1開始到sdb4,邏輯分區(qū)從sdb5開始,(邏輯分區(qū)永遠(yuǎn)從sdb5開始…)設(shè)備名可以使用fdisk –l查看
2.分區(qū)詳解
使用ssh遠(yuǎn)程連接工具登錄到系統(tǒng),使用fdisk -l命令查看磁盤狀態(tài)
![](/d/20211018/1c54745ebaba8b1e01550462fc099372.gif)
此處可以看到兩塊硬盤hda和hdb,第一塊硬盤hda是裝好系統(tǒng)的。hdb硬盤是未進(jìn)行分區(qū)的。
本例將這個(gè)10G的硬盤分區(qū),分區(qū)計(jì)劃:分一個(gè)主分區(qū) ,大小3G,文件格式ext3.三個(gè)邏輯分區(qū),大小分別為2G,2G,3G。實(shí)際分區(qū)個(gè)數(shù)和大小可論情況所定。
下面就是分區(qū)的詳細(xì)步驟,由于是每一步都進(jìn)行了截圖和說明,內(nèi)容略顯復(fù)雜,其實(shí)很簡單。
輸入 fdisk /dev/hdb 然后回車,給硬盤進(jìn)行分區(qū)。如下圖
![](/d/20211018/3d3df4913af695718d3fb55c9be438c2.gif)
輸入n回車新建分區(qū),接著再輸入p回車新建主分區(qū),如圖
![](/d/20211018/647720c0474af4787c0da13604380992.gif)
此處要求選擇分區(qū)號在1-4間,輸入1回車
![](/d/20211018/e60ca620c4d1a3777fd5f80837621db9.gif)
First cylinder (1-20805, default 1):這里是設(shè)置分區(qū)起始的柱面,直接回車選擇默認(rèn)即可,回車后如下圖
![](/d/20211018/858c6b3310ae110662d1f65b79d442ae.gif)
Last cylinder or +size or +sizeM or +sizeK (1-20805, default 20805):此處是設(shè)置分區(qū)結(jié)束柱面,+3G表示從起始柱面開始向后3G結(jié)束,也是是設(shè)置分區(qū)大小為3G,輸入+3G后回車,如下圖所示
![](/d/20211018/9c65781eaaeebf862253ddbe1bb27a01.gif)
此處可輸入p查看分區(qū)是否成功,輸入p回車,如下圖:顯示分區(qū)成功
![](/d/20211018/41f825cfe7861f6bd710072dc31fb303.gif)
接下來我們就劃分?jǐn)U展分區(qū),按n回車
![](/d/20211018/d91331a79ee8cf116182602544b20eaa.gif)
這里輸入e,表示創(chuàng)建擴(kuò)展分區(qū),輸入e回車
![](/d/20211018/2ce58b6e84cbc51532758624efaefd75.gif)
輸入分區(qū)號2回車
![](/d/20211018/25fe29cbd3806b786dc9713645cdbdc1.gif)
此處直接按回車鍵,表示選擇默認(rèn)
![](/d/20211018/368625fb866062e1f5bb0e518ce760aa.gif)
此處也是直接回車選擇默認(rèn),表示將劃分第一個(gè)主分區(qū)后的磁盤全部劃分個(gè)這個(gè)邏輯分區(qū)
![](/d/20211018/489f269aac930460f5aa762a2d974ae0.gif)
此處可在此輸入命令p查看當(dāng)前分區(qū)狀態(tài),如下圖
![](/d/20211018/818121eda84f1159b11dae58e13b01a4.gif)
此處就開始劃分?jǐn)U展分區(qū)hdb2下的邏輯分區(qū)吧!接著上圖,輸入命令n回車
![](/d/20211018/4b8dfc14805a1f9260c403076f602766.gif)
此處輸入l表示選擇創(chuàng)建邏輯分區(qū),輸入l回車
![](/d/20211018/aa0a3ef637691566c86832fabb61ecaf.gif)
此處直接使用回車,表示選擇默認(rèn)
![](/d/20211018/0a6816893d1cce964cae906fc3d34e67.gif)
此處輸入+2G,表示劃分分區(qū)大小為2G,輸入+2G回車
![](/d/20211018/07ebeebd15a7a95d83df91f49162a77b.gif)
此處要按計(jì)劃再劃分出兩個(gè)邏輯空間,輸入n回車,然后輸入l回車選擇邏輯分區(qū),然后直接回車選擇默認(rèn)起始柱面,輸入+2G回車設(shè)置分區(qū)大小
![](/d/20211018/4b3999b44bedec4d45f53351dee2f407.gif)
下面就要將擴(kuò)展分區(qū)的磁盤大小全部分給最后一個(gè)邏輯分區(qū),輸入n回車,然后輸入l選擇邏輯分區(qū),然后直接回車選擇默認(rèn)起始柱面,最后不設(shè)置磁盤大小直接回車
![](/d/20211018/a6cd276e0ac8903a46c1c36f45f35997.gif)
再次輸入p查看當(dāng)前分區(qū)狀態(tài)
![](/d/20211018/c65fce78604eb22bec87b6e2c7af8fab.gif)
劃分的空間與我們計(jì)劃劃分相同,最后輸入w回車,進(jìn)行保存退出。
再次使用fdisk -l命令就可以查看到磁盤hdb已經(jīng)分區(qū)成功。
![](/d/20211018/c16c090759801155038b577bde4174ac.gif)
磁盤劃分成功,下面就要對分區(qū)進(jìn)行格式化了
使用命令 mkfs -t ext3 /dev/hdb1
mkfs -t ext3 /dev/hdb5
mkfs -t ext3 /dev/hdb6
mkfs -t ext3 /dev/hdb7
分別對磁盤進(jìn)行格式化處理,格式化為ext3文件類型
自此分區(qū)流程算是完成啦!
附:fdisk和mkfs,mkswap命令的參數(shù)解釋
Fdisk命令詳解:
m:獲取幫助
n:新建分區(qū)
p:顯示分區(qū)表
d:刪除分區(qū)
b:設(shè)置卷標(biāo)
w:寫入分區(qū)表
t:改變分區(qū)文件系統(tǒng)類型
v:檢驗(yàn)分區(qū)
l:顯示fdisk所支持的文件系統(tǒng)代碼
q:退出
文件系統(tǒng)的建立:
mkfs參數(shù)分區(qū)
-t文件系統(tǒng)類型指定建立的文件系統(tǒng)類型
注:mkfs –t ext3 =mkfs.ext3
-c建立文件系統(tǒng)之前檢查有無壞道
-l文件名:從文件中讀取壞道的情況
-v顯示詳細(xì)情況
mkswap 分區(qū)在分區(qū)上建立交換分區(qū)
例:在hdb7上建立交換分區(qū)命令如下:
mkswap/etc/hdb7